Donegal swimmer raises €5,000 in aid of Arranmore RNLI

Ranafast's Elaine O'Donnell has been swimming for 796 consecutive days and held her 50th birthday in aid of Arranmore RNLI

Donegal swimmer raises €5,000 in aid of Arranmore RNLI

L-R Jerry Early, Elaine Boyle-O’Donnell, Frank Green

Elaine ‘Pops’ Boyle-O'Donnell presented a cheque worth €5,000 to Arranmore RNLI. 

Elaine, accompanied by her sea-swimming group “Bouys and Gulls”, has been taking the plunge for 796 consecutive days on the Donegal coast. The Ranafast native also held her 50th birthday celebrations in Bonners Bar, Mullaghduff, in aid of the Arranmore RNLI.

Through this, she raised €5,000 and presented the sum to the fundraising team. “Today, we had a very special guest visit us on Arranmore,” Arranmore RNLI said.
